Hello everyone,
Just a quick stupid question. I have a set of the Rubicon Express front lower bumpstops (part #: RE1380 http://www.rubiconexpress.com/Produc...=39EB796732415 ).
I cannot figure out how this part is supposed to be installed. The RE website says it goes inside of the spring on the bottom, but there's no place to screw it into on the bottom spring perch. ??? I know I'm missing something here.
Any help would be much appreciated.
gotta drill it bro. We had to drill holes for my 06. Just drill holes in the center of that plate on the bottom and botl those bad boys in.
